Highlights
Are people in Closter older or younger than people in Califon?
- The Median Age in Closter is 0.2 years older than in Califon.

Are housing costs cheaper in Closter or Califon?
- Closter housing costs are 36.2% more expensive than Califon hous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Closter or Califon?
- The average commute for residents of Closter is 1.1 minutes longer than it is for residents of Califon.
